Всем доброго времени суток!Встала задача запустить mrtg, а я эти куклы первый раз вижу:/.
Поставил федору 6, настроил на циске 1005 snmp (циска для тестов) и ввел следующие строки в конфиг mrtg:
Target[CiscoRouter]: 2:bla-bla-bla...@192.168.0.1
MaxBytes[CiscoRouter]: 1250000
Title[CiscoRouter]: Test
PageTop[CiscoRouter]: <H1> Test </H1>
ну и запустил mrtg.у меня в в домашнем каталоге mrtg появились файлы со статистикой, но без индекса. Я вычитал вот про такую штуку как phpMrtgAdmin (http://phpmrtgadmin.sourceforge.net), но у меня не получилось добиться в ней отображения этого роутера. У нее есть файл конфигурации, где надо задать путь к домашнему каталогу mrtg относительно DOCUMET_ROOT (у меня это получается ../mrtg, т.е. домашний каталог на один уровень выше, чем документ рут (я так понимаю, что документ рут - это апачевский)), но я так и не вижу своего роутера:(. Кто-нибудь работал с этой прогой? Может подскажите что не так?
И вообще, а что можно еще подобное использовать?
>Всем доброго времени суток!
>
>Встала задача запустить mrtg, а я эти куклы первый раз вижу:/.
>
>Поставил федору 6, настроил на циске 1005 snmp (циска для тестов) и
>ввел следующие строки в конфиг mrtg:
>
>Target[CiscoRouter]: 2:bla-bla-bla...@192.168.0.1
>MaxBytes[CiscoRouter]: 1250000
>Title[CiscoRouter]: Test
>PageTop[CiscoRouter]: <H1> Test </H1>
>
>ну и запустил mrtg.
>
>у меня в в домашнем каталоге mrtg появились файлы со статистикой, но
>без индекса. Я вычитал вот про такую штуку как phpMrtgAdmin (http://phpmrtgadmin.sourceforge.net),
>но у меня не получилось добиться в ней отображения этого роутера.
>У нее есть файл конфигурации, где надо задать путь к домашнему
>каталогу mrtg относительно DOCUMET_ROOT (у меня это получается ../mrtg, т.е. домашний
>каталог на один уровень выше, чем документ рут (я так понимаю,
>что документ рут - это апачевский)), но я так и не
>вижу своего роутера:(. Кто-нибудь работал с этой прогой? Может подскажите что
>не так?
>
>И вообще, а что можно еще подобное использовать?
написал веб интерфейс к ней, но вот немогу дописать мануал. Если интересно могу поделиться. Но бубен нужен без мануала.
>написал веб интерфейс к ней, но вот немогу дописать мануал. Если интересно
>могу поделиться. Но бубен нужен без мануала.Я был бы рад попробовать прикрутить авторский интерфейс:). Где-то можно качнуть? Или готов принять на мыло vist@inbox.ru.
>
>>написал веб интерфейс к ней, но вот немогу дописать мануал. Если интересно
>>могу поделиться. Но бубен нужен без мануала.
>
>Я был бы рад попробовать прикрутить авторский интерфейс:). Где-то можно качнуть? Или
>готов принять на мыло vist@inbox.ru.
на почте
>
>>написал веб интерфейс к ней, но вот немогу дописать мануал. Если интересно
>>могу поделиться. Но бубен нужен без мануала.
>
>Я был бы рад попробовать прикрутить авторский интерфейс:). Где-то можно качнуть? Или
>готов принять на мыло vist@inbox.ru.а можно автору обсуждаемого веб-интерфейса посмотреть на ваш продукт?
если можно - вышлите пожалуйста на мыло,
которое написано в самом низу страницы http://phpmrtgadmin.sourceforge.net/хотелось бы учесть все свои недочеты
>>
>>>написал веб интерфейс к ней, но вот немогу дописать мануал. Если интересно
>>>могу поделиться. Но бубен нужен без мануала.
>>
>>Я был бы рад попробовать прикрутить авторский интерфейс:). Где-то можно качнуть? Или
>>готов принять на мыло vist@inbox.ru.
>
>а можно автору обсуждаемого веб-интерфейса посмотреть на ваш продукт?
>если можно - вышлите пожалуйста на мыло,
>которое написано в самом низу страницы http://phpmrtgadmin.sourceforge.net/
>
>хотелось бы учесть все свои недочетыпосмотреть на него можно, но толку не будет, так как я его писал несколько минут и я несильно знаю перл :) просто мне было удобно навоять для инженеров, что то подобное.
но если после этих слов всетаки интересно могу выслать.
>>если можно - вышлите пожалуйста на мыло,
>>которое написано в самом низу страницы http://phpmrtgadmin.sourceforge.net/
>>
>>хотелось бы учесть все свои недочеты
>
>посмотреть на него можно, но толку не будет, так как я его
>писал несколько минут и я несильно знаю перл :) просто мне
ведь мне тоже пришлось "ваять" для инженеров.
для этих целей перл лучше, но знаю его хуже, чем РНР, а писать надо было быстро.
просто со временем, проект обрастал всякими примочками>было удобно навоять для инженеров, что то подобное.
>но если после этих слов всетаки интересно могу выслать.
конечно интересно.
адрес ящика - там же.
>>>если можно - вышлите пожалуйста на мыло,
>>>которое написано в самом низу страницы http://phpmrtgadmin.sourceforge.net/
>>>
>>>хотелось бы учесть все свои недочеты
>>
>>посмотреть на него можно, но толку не будет, так как я его
>>писал несколько минут и я несильно знаю перл :) просто мне
>ведь мне тоже пришлось "ваять" для инженеров.
>для этих целей перл лучше, но знаю его хуже, чем РНР, а
>писать надо было быстро.
>просто со временем, проект обрастал всякими примочками
>
>>было удобно навоять для инженеров, что то подобное.
>>но если после этих слов всетаки интересно могу выслать.
>конечно интересно.
>адрес ящика - там же.
ок выслал.
>Всем доброго времени суток!
>
>Встала задача запустить mrtg, а я эти куклы первый раз вижу:/.
>
>Поставил федору 6, настроил на циске 1005 snmp (циска для тестов) и
>ввел следующие строки в конфиг mrtg:
>
>Target[CiscoRouter]: 2:bla-bla-bla...@192.168.0.1
>MaxBytes[CiscoRouter]: 1250000
>Title[CiscoRouter]: Test
>PageTop[CiscoRouter]: <H1> Test </h1>
>
>ну и запустил mrtg.
>
>у меня в в домашнем каталоге mrtg появились файлы со статистикой, но
>без индекса. Я вычитал вот про такую штуку как phpMrtgAdmin (http://phpmrtgadmin.sourceforge.net),
>но у меня не получилось добиться в ней отображения этого роутера.
>У нее есть файл конфигурации, где надо задать путь к домашнему
>каталогу mrtg относительно DOCUMET_ROOT (у меня это получается ../mrtg, т.е. домашний
>каталог на один уровень выше, чем документ рут (я так понимаю,
>что документ рут - это апачевский)), но я так и не
>вижу своего роутера:(. Кто-нибудь работал с этой прогой? Может подскажите что
>не так?
>
>И вообще, а что можно еще подобное использовать?
indexmaker mrtg.cfg > $DOCUMENT_ROOT/index.html
>indexmaker mrtg.cfg > $DOCUMENT_ROOT/index.htmlСпасибо, а я чет и не подумал об этом:) (не думал, что indexmaker идет в комплекте). У меня вот еще в чем проблема. Хочу мониторить каналы frame-relay по DLCI (http://www.somix.com/support/mrtg_repository.php?cmd=device&...):
на циске у меня PVC с DLCI 101, конфиг следующий:
Target[$CFGNAME]: 1.3.6.1.2.1.10.32.2.1.9.$DLCI&1.3.6.1.2.1.10.32.2.1.7.$DLCI:$COMMUNITY@$IPADDRESS
MaxBytes[$CFGNAME]: $CIR
AbsMax[$CFGNAME]: $MAX
Options[$CFGNAME]: bits, unknaszero
Title[$CFGNAME]: $DEVICE
PageTop[$CFGNAME]: <H1>$DEVICE</H1>
YLegend[$CFGNAME]: bps
ShortLegend[$CFGNAME]: bps
LegendI[$CFGNAME]: In
LegendO[$CFGNAME]: Out
Legend1[$CFGNAME]: Inbound Frame Utilization
Legend2[$CFGNAME]: Outbound Frame Utilization
Legend3[$CFGNAME]: INBOUND Max value per interval on graph
Legend4[$CFGNAME]: OUTBOUND Max value per interval on graph
Colours[$CFGNAME]: GREEN#00eb0c,BLUE#0000ff,GRAY#AAAAAA,VIOLET#ff00ff
WithPeak[$CFGNAME]: ymw
Но у меня mrtg ругается:[root@mrtg mrtg]# env LANG=C /usr/bin/mrtg /etc/mrtg/mrtg.cfg
Monday, 5 February 2007 at 21:13: ERROR: Target[c1005-dlci101][_IN_] '1.3.6.1.2.1.10.32.2.1.9.101&1.3.6.1.2.1.10.32.2.1.7.101:ххххх&@$192.168.0.1' (eval): syntax error at (eval 18) line 1, near "1.3.6.1.2.1.10.32.2.1.7.101:"
Missing right curly or square bracket at (eval 18) line 2, at end of lineMonday, 5 February 2007 at 21:13: ERROR: Target[c1005-dlci101][_OUT_] '1.3.6.1.2.1.10.32.2.1.9.101&1.3.6.1.2.1.10.32.2.1.7.101:ххххх&@$192.168.0.1' (eval): syntax error at (eval 19) line 1, near "1.3.6.1.2.1.10.32.2.1.7.101:"
Missing right curly or square bracket at (eval 19) line 2, at end of lineКто-нибудь может подсказать в чем проблема?
>Всем доброго времени суток!
>
>Встала задача запустить mrtg, а я эти куклы первый раз вижу:/.
>
>Поставил федору 6, настроил на циске 1005 snmp (циска для тестов) и
>ввел следующие строки в конфиг mrtg:
>
>Target[CiscoRouter]: 2:bla-bla-bla...@192.168.0.1
>MaxBytes[CiscoRouter]: 1250000
>Title[CiscoRouter]: Test
>PageTop[CiscoRouter]: <H1> Test </H1>
>
>ну и запустил mrtg.
>
>у меня в в домашнем каталоге mrtg появились файлы со статистикой, но
>без индекса. Я вычитал вот про такую штуку как phpMrtgAdmin (http://phpmrtgadmin.sourceforge.net),
>но у меня не получилось добиться в ней отображения этого роутера.
насколько я помню MRTG - там нужно указывать полностью router@community
и еще пользовать indexmaker.>У нее есть файл конфигурации, где надо задать путь к домашнему
>каталогу mrtg относительно DOCUMET_ROOT (у меня это получается ../mrtg, т.е. домашний
>каталог на один уровень выше, чем документ рут (я так понимаю,
>что документ рут - это апачевский)), но я так и не
>вижу своего роутера:(. Кто-нибудь работал с этой прогой? Может подскажите что
>не так?
>
>И вообще, а что можно еще подобное использовать?в доках к phpmrtgadmin я описал как и что ставить
DOCUMENT_ROOT - это где у вас лежит/будет лежать web-интерфейс - он может быть и непривязанным к апачевскому корнюнапример у меня стоит так
тут лежит Apache полностью
/usr/local/apache/*тут лежит MRTG "из коробки"
/usr/local/mrtg/*фактически, для phpmrtgadmin я добавил только три каталога
/usr/local/mrtg/cfg - тут у меня лежат конфиги, в которых у меня описано - что читать, как сохранять, куда складывать
/usr/local/mrtg/htdocs - web-интерфейс phpmrtgadmin
/usr/local/mrtg/htdocs/mrtg/ - все генерируемые файлыглавное, чтобы сам MRTG складывал свои файлы туда, откуда phpmrtgadmin будет их брать